The Friends of Radnor Lake and The Chestnut Group, a Nashville-based nonprofit organization of plein air painters, will host the popular biannual fundraising art show, Love the Lake, Love the Land. A major portion of the sale proceeds of this artwork will benefit the Radnor Lake State Natural Area.
Chestnut Group plein air painters are a group of artists who partner with other nonprofit organizations to raise funds to protect our vanishing landscapes. “Plein air” is a French expression for painting outside in the open. Chestnut members have been painting the seasons at Radnor Lake in preparation for the show. The show will feature Radnor Lake scenes, the abundant wildlife including birds of prey found in the Barbara J. Mapp Aviary Education Center and scenes from existing and newly acquired property within the Natural Area. The funds raised will help Friends of Radnor Lake to continue its efforts to expand and protect this unique Tennessee State Park.
